Hurtado, Lourdes – Journal of Educational Media, Memory and Society, 2023
This article examines a school textbook, the "Manual de Instrucción Primaria," which the Peruvian military created in the 1930s in order to help to redeem their indigenous recruits from their racialized backgrounds. On the one hand, the textbook echoed Peruvian elites' anxieties about the suitability of their indigenous contingents to…

Reppy, Judith; Long, F. A. – Bulletin of the Atomic Scientists, 1976
"Independent Research and Development" for the Defense Department costs United States taxpayers about one billion dollars a year. Facts about the program are hard to uncover, but two members of Cornell University's Program on Science, Technology, and Society have investigated the program and conclude that Congress should exert greater control.…
